3 Debt slavery becomes more understandable when one recalls that the barangay existed on a subsistence economy, i.e. only enough of the staple crop was grown which was required for the barangay's consumption and for seed for the next planting. There was no surplus. Hence, borrowed rice was in effect seed rice. It was thought just that the borrower should return not only the quantity borrowed but a quantity bearing some relationship to what the rice would have produced had it been planted. Inability to do so justified a lien on services. The practice was probably extended to other commodities. For other reasons for slavery, see Pedro Chirino, Relación de las Islas Filipinas (Rome, 1604), Ch. 46.

6 In the nineteenth century the functions of the cabeza de barangay became more complicated. But by this time the barangay ceased being a kinship unit, and had become merely a political unit of society. This was in great part due to increased mobility of the population. See Manuel Azcarraga y Palermo, La reforma del municipio indigena (Madrid, 1871).
